(Bloomberg) — Mark Zuckerberg argued in federal court that his company’s social networks aren’t just about friends, taking the stand as the first witness for the US Federal Trade Commission’s antitrust trial.
Allowing people to connect with friends and family “remains one of our priorities,” Zuckerberg said. However, “we’ve always been a service that lets you discover and learn about what’s going on in the world.”
